Is a GTI a safe car?
According to the authority when it comes to safety – the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ration, the GTI gets a five-star overall and side crash rating and four-star frontal crash and rollover rating. The 2025 Volkswagen GTI gets good safety ratings from the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ety.
Is the 2010 GTI a good car?
Though not as blindingly quick as its top peers, the 2010 Volkswagen GTI is still satisfyingly fleet, with ample midrange power from its turbocharged four. It also features one of the better-sounding four-cylinders on the market, singing a surprisingly throaty tune at full throttle. For pure sporting intentions, the GTI hot-hatch is the clear winner here, far more fun to toss around.
